Norfolk Island (NF) My Account

Zenbu Most Recent Users Page 5287

Displaying users 105721 - 105723 of 105723 in total
Kompass Since July 31, 2006 Edits (16047)
tonto Since July 26, 2006 Edits (92)
zenbu Since July 05, 2006 Edits (134707)
About Zenbu
Creative Commons License
Zenbu content is licensed under a Creative Commons Attribution 3.0 License